Purpose of IEC 60287-3-1:2017

The purpose of

IEC 60287-3-1:2017

is to define the site reference conditions used when determining the current rating of electric cables. In practice, this type of reference document helps establish a consistent technical foundation for engineering calculations, especially where installation context influences allowable loading. It is relevant when teams need a common point of reference for documented evaluation, technical review, and performance assessment of cable systems under expected operating conditions.
